Does anyone have service info or part numbers for BML-161 - LPE/KPC Multi charger?

I have one with a bad power supply (switched mode). I have no service info on it.
I think there are different versions of this, this has the power supply with three daughter boards next to it acrossed the back. Each daughter board runs two pockets.

What I am looking for is a part number and rough price for the complete supply if they are available. Maybe the whole thing is a throw away!

If it is the BML 161 51/024 then the power supply part number is F29/4R-A9-0091 but they are no longer available. They last listed for about $250.

There may be an easy fix. There is a voltage output adjustment pot and it may need to be adjusted or just cleaned up. Unplug the charger and note the current position of the pot. Turn the pot full deflection back and forth several times to clean it off. You can use a dab of contact cleaner as well. Do not wipe it back and forth with the unit plugged in and turned on as this will blow the power supply. After you're done exercising it and any contact cleaner has dried set the pot back to its starting position.

Plug the charger in and turn it on. With a voltmeter , read any of the outputs to the three daughter boards. You should have 15 VDC ± 0.2 V. If necessary, slowly adjust the pot until it reaches this value.

I have been able to return several chargers back into service this way.
